Potential Drug-Drug Interactions in Critically Ill Medical Patients: A Cross-Sectional Study
Background: Drug interaction commonly occurred in critically ill patients and may increase hospital lengths of stay and total cost. The aim of the present study is to evaluate potential drug-drug interaction in critically ill patients. Methods: In this cross-sectional study, medical records of crit...
